A Arquitetura Empresarial é a base da estratégia organizacional. Ela define como as capacidades de negócios se alinham com as capacidades tecnológicas e os fluxos de dados. No entanto, um modelo estático é insuficiente. A empresa moderna é dinâmica, e a arquitetura deve evoluir junto com ela. Para navegar essa complexidade, as organizações precisam de um método para avaliar a integridade estrutural de seus modelos arquitetônicos. É aqui que a avaliação da saúde da arquitetura se torna crítica. Ao utilizarmétricas ArchiMate, os interessados ganham visibilidade sobre a estabilidade, agilidade e manutenibilidade de sua paisagem de TI.
Sem medição, as decisões arquitetônicas tornam-se baseadas na intuição, e não em evidências. Este guia fornece um quadro abrangente para entender como avaliar a qualidade arquitetônica. Exploraremos métricas específicas derivadas do padrão de modelagem ArchiMate, discutiremos estratégias de implementação e destacaremos armadilhas comuns a evitar. O objetivo é estabelecer um ciclo robusto de governança que garanta que sua arquitetura permaneça um ativo confiável.

Por que medir a saúde da arquitetura? 🤔
Muitas organizações tratam a documentação arquitetônica como um exercício de conformidade. Elas criam diagramas para atender aos requisitos de auditoria, mas esses modelos rapidamente ficam desatualizados. Medir a saúde da arquitetura desloca o foco da documentação para o valor. Transforma o modelo de uma imagem estática em uma ferramenta viva de análise.
Existem vários fatores-chave para a implementação de métricas arquitetônicas:
- Redução de Riscos:Identificar dependências frágeis evita falhas no sistema durante atualizações. Se um componente tecnológico específico tiver demasiadas conexões, alterá-lo poderia causar impactos em toda a ecossistema.
- Otimização de Custos:As métricas revelam redundâncias. Você pode encontrar múltiplas aplicações atendendo a mesma função de negócios, resultando em custos desnecessários com licenciamento e manutenção.
- Avaliação de Agilidade:Uma arquitetura saudável suporta mudanças. O acoplamento alto torna difícil modificar partes do sistema sem afetar outras. As métricas quantificam essa resistência à mudança.
- Verificação de Alinhamento:Garantir que os investimentos em tecnologia realmente apoiem os objetivos de negócios. Se a estratégia de negócios mudar, a arquitetura deve refletir essa mudança rapidamente.
Ao quantificar esses aspectos, a liderança pode tomar decisões informadas sobre onde investir recursos. Isso transforma a conversa de conceitos abstratos em pontos de dados concretos.
Compreendendo Camadas e Relacionamentos ArchiMate 🧱
Para medir a saúde de forma eficaz, é necessário compreender a estrutura do padrão ArchiMate. O ArchiMate divide a arquitetura empresarial em várias camadas e domínios. Cada camada representa uma perspectiva diferente sobre a organização.
As camadas padrão incluem:
- Estratégia:Define os requisitos de negócios, princípios e objetivos. É a base do modelo.
- Negócios:Descreve os processos de negócios, papéis e interações. Essa camada conecta estratégia à execução.
- Aplicação:Detalha as aplicações de software e serviços que automatizam os processos de negócios.
- Tecnologia:Cobre o hardware, redes e infraestrutura que hospedam as aplicações.
- Físico:Representa os nós de hardware reais e localizações.
A saúde não se limita apenas aos elementos dentro dessas camadas, mas também àsrelações entre elas. O ArchiMate define tipos específicos de relacionamentos, como Atribuição, Agregação, Composição, Realização e Acesso. A saúde do modelo depende fortemente de como esses relacionamentos são utilizados.
Por exemplo, excesso deAcessorelacionamentos entre aplicações e processos de negócios pode indicar a necessidade de uma melhor abstração. Por outro lado, a falta deAtribuiçãorelacionamentos entre papéis e processos pode sugerir responsabilidades pouco claras. Compreender esses mecanismos é o primeiro passo para definir métricas significativas.
Métricas Principais para Avaliação de Arquitetura 📏
Nem todas as métricas são iguais. Algumas são métricas de vaidade que parecem boas em um painel, mas não oferecem nenhuma visão sobre a estabilidade do sistema. Para obter valor real, foque em métricas que estejam correlacionadas com esforço de manutenção, risco e flexibilidade. A tabela a seguir apresenta as métricas essenciais para avaliar a saúde da arquitetura.
| Nome da Métrica | Definição | O que Indica | Estado Alvo |
|---|---|---|---|
| Grau de Acoplamento | Número de dependências que um componente tem sobre outros. | Complexidade do sistema e risco de mudança. | Baixo (Modular) |
| Pontuação de Coesão | Quão relacionados estão os elementos dentro de um componente. | Clareza e foco nas responsabilidades. | Alto (Focado) |
| Cobertura de Camadas | Porcentagem de funções de negócios mapeadas para aplicações. | Completude da alinhamento entre negócios e TI. | Alto (100%) |
| Razão de Impacto de Mudança | Número de elementos downstream afetados por uma mudança. | Estabilidade e manutenibilidade. | Baixo (Previsível) |
| Contagem de Redundância | Número de capacidades ou serviços duplicados. | Eficiência de custo e desperdício. | Baixo (Mínimo) |
Vamos analisar essas métricas com mais detalhes para entender como são calculadas e interpretadas.
1. Grau de Acoplamento 🔗
O acoplamento refere-se ao grau de interdependência entre módulos de software ou componentes arquitetônicos. Em termos de ArchiMate, isso envolve frequentemente relacionamentos comoAcesso, Atribuição, ou Fluxo. Um alto acoplamento significa que, para alterar um elemento, é necessário alterar ou entender muitos outros.
Por que isso importa:
- Manutenibilidade: Um alto acoplamento aumenta o tempo necessário para corrigir erros ou adicionar funcionalidades.
- Estabilidade: Sistemas com alto acoplamento são propensos a falhas em cadeia.
- Escalabilidade: É difícil escalar um sistema fortemente acoplado sem uma refatoração significativa.
Como medir: Conte as relações de saída e entrada para serviços ou componentes de aplicativos específicos. Uma aplicação com 50 dependências de entrada é mais arriscada do que uma com 5. Monitorar essa métrica ao longo do tempo ajuda a identificar se a arquitetura está se tornando mais complexa ou mais simples.
2. Pontuação de Coesão 🎯
A coesão mede o quão fortemente relacionados e focados estão os responsabilidades de um único módulo. No contexto do ArchiMate, isso pode ser observado na forma como um processo de negócios é mapeado para um serviço de aplicativo específico. Alta coesão significa que um componente faz uma coisa bem.
Por que isso importa:
- Compreensibilidade: As equipes conseguem entender rapidamente o propósito de um componente.
- Reutilização: Componentes altamente coesos podem ser reutilizados em contextos diferentes sem efeitos colaterais.
- Isolamento: Os problemas são contidos dentro do componente em vez de se espalharem.
Como medir: Analise as relações entre um processo de negócios e os aplicativos de suporte. Se um único processo de negócios depende de 10 aplicativos diferentes, a coesão é baixa. Se depende de um único serviço bem definido, a coesão é alta.
3. Cobertura de Camadas 🌐
A cobertura garante que a estratégia de negócios seja totalmente apoiada pela tecnologia subjacente. Se um processo de negócios existe no modelo, mas não tem suporte de aplicativo, pode ser manual ou inexistente. Se um aplicativo existe, mas não tem suporte de processo de negócios, pode ser um desperdício legado.
Por que isso importa:
- Alinhamento Estratégico: Confirma que os investimentos em tecnologia atendem às necessidades do negócio.
- Análise de Lacunas: Destaca áreas em que o negócio não é suportado ou está excessivamente projetado.
- Modernização: Identifica sistemas legados que já não atendem a uma finalidade de negócios.
Como medir: Calcule a razão entre processos de negócios e serviços de aplicativos. Uma razão de 1:1 é ideal para mapeamento, embora algumas relações muitos para um sejam aceitáveis para serviços compartilhados.
4. Razão de Impacto de Mudança ⚡
Este métrico estima o esforço necessário para fazer uma mudança. É calculado rastreando as dependências a partir de um elemento de origem (por exemplo, um servidor) até todos os elementos downstream (por exemplo, aplicativos, serviços de negócios).
Por que isso importa:
- Gestão de Riscos: Ajuda a avaliar o risco de janelas planejadas de manutenção.
- Estimativa de Custos: Fornece uma base para calcular o custo das mudanças arquitetônicas.
- Apoio à Decisão: Ajuda a escolher entre alternativas com perfis de impacto diferentes.
5. Contagem de Redundância 🔄
A redundância ocorre quando múltiplos componentes realizam a mesma função. Embora alguma redundância seja boa para alta disponibilidade, a redundância desnecessária aumenta o custo e a complexidade.
Por que isso importa:
- Controle de Custos: Reduz os gastos com licenciamento e infraestrutura.
- Complexidade: Reduz o número de sistemas a serem gerenciados e protegidos.
- Consistência:Garante que dados e processos sejam consistentes em toda a empresa.
Implementação do Processo de Medição 🛠️
Definir métricas é uma coisa; implementá-las é outra. Você não pode simplesmente instalar uma ferramenta e esperar que os dados apareçam. O processo exige disciplina e um quadro claro de governança. Siga estas etapas para estabelecer uma rotina de medição.
Passo 1: Defina o Escopo e os Padrões
Antes de medir, estabeleça o que constitui um modelo válido. Defina convenções de nomeação, regras de relacionamento e definições de camadas. Sem padronização, as métricas serão inconsistentes. Por exemplo, decida como você define um Processo de Negócio. É uma função de alto nível ou uma tarefa específica? Essa definição deve ser consistente em toda a organização.
Passo 2: Coleta e Validação de Dados
Reúna os dados do seu repositório de arquitetura. Isso frequentemente envolve a exportação de modelos ou a consulta ao banco de dados. A validação é crucial aqui. Certifique-se de que os dados são precisos. Se o modelo estiver desatualizado, as métricas serão enganosas. Implemente um ciclo de revisão em que arquitetos aprovem os dados antes de serem usados para relatórios.
Passo 3: Análise e Benchmarking
Uma vez coletados, analise os dados em relação aos seus objetivos. Compare as métricas atuais com dados históricos. Os níveis de acoplamento estão aumentando? A cobertura está melhorando? Se você tiver múltias unidades de negócios, faça benchmarking entre elas. Isso ajuda a identificar boas práticas e áreas que precisam de melhoria.
Passo 4: Relatórios e Ação
Métricas são inúteis se não impulsionarem ações. Crie relatórios adaptados a diferentes públicos. Executivos de nível C precisam de resumos de alto nível sobre riscos e alinhamento. Arquitetos precisam de análises detalhadas sobre acoplamento e redundância. Certifique-se de que cada métrica esteja vinculada a uma ação. Se uma métrica estiver vermelha, atribua uma tarefa para resolvê-la.
Interpretação dos Dados: Alertas Vermelhos vs Alertas Verdes 🚩
Nem todas as desvios em relação ao estado alvo são ruins, mas a maioria exige investigação. Compreender o contexto é essencial para interpretar corretamente os resultados.
Alertas Vermelhos Comuns
- Alto Acoplamento em Sistemas Críticos: Se o aplicativo de negócios principal tiver alto acoplamento, o risco de falha é significativo.
- Cobertura Zero: Se uma capacidade de negócios crítica não tiver suporte de aplicação, a organização pode estar dependendo de sistemas de TI sombra ou planilhas manuais.
- Elementos Órfãos: Elementos que existem no modelo, mas não têm relacionamentos, provavelmente estão desatualizados e devem ser arquivados.
- Dependência Vertical Excessiva: Se a camada de Tecnologia estiver fortemente acoplada à camada de Negócios sem a camada de Aplicação como intermediária, a arquitetura carece de abstração.
Alertas Verdes Comuns
- Camadas de Abstração Claras: Aplicações protegem o negócio das mudanças na tecnologia.
- Estrutura Modular: Componentes são autocontidos e interagem por meio de interfaces bem definidas.
- Modelos Atualizados: O modelo reflete com precisão o estado atual da empresa.
- Nomenclatura Consistente: Os elementos são nomeados de forma consistente, tornando o modelo legível e pesquisável.
Gestão e Manutenção 👮♂️
A saúde da arquitetura não é uma conquista única. É um estado contínuo que exige manutenção ativa. A governança é o quadro que garante que a arquitetura permaneça saudável ao longo do tempo.
Atividades-Chave de Governança:
- Conselhos de Revisão de Arquitetura: Reuniões regulares para revisar as mudanças propostas em conformidade com os padrões de arquitetura. Isso evita que a dívida técnica se acumule.
- Versionamento de Modelos: Rastreie as mudanças no modelo ao longo do tempo. Isso permite que você veja como as métricas evoluem.
- Treinamento: Garanta que arquitetos e partes interessadas compreendam o padrão ArchiMate. O mal-entendido da linguagem leva a práticas de modelagem inadequadas.
- Ciclos de Auditoria: Audite periodicamente o repositório para garantir a qualidade dos dados. Remova elementos obsoletos e atualize relacionamentos desatualizados.
Ao integrar essas atividades ao ciclo de vida do projeto, a arquitetura torna-se uma parte natural de como a organização opera, em vez de uma carga administrativa separada.
Armadilhas Comuns a Evitar ⚠️
Mesmo com as melhores intenções, as organizações frequentemente tropeçam ao tentar medir a saúde da arquitetura. Estar ciente dessas armadilhas pode poupar tempo e esforço.
- Sobre-modelagem: Criar muito detalhe pode tornar o modelo inviável. Foque na arquitetura que importa para a tomada de decisões. Ignore detalhes de implementação que não afetam o planejamento estratégico.
- Dependência de Ferramentas: Não dependa exclusivamente do software para gerar métricas. A ferramenta fornece os dados, mas julgamento humano é necessário para interpretar o contexto.
- Ignorar a Visão de Negócios: Focar apenas nas métricas tecnológicas ignora a visão geral. A arquitetura deve servir primeiro aos negócios.
- Parâmetros Estáticos: Os parâmetros devem evoluir. O acoplamento aceitável há dez anos pode ser inaceitável hoje devido ao surgimento de microserviços e computação em nuvem.
Pensamentos Finais sobre a Maturidade Arquitetônica 🚀
Avaliar a saúde da arquitetura usando métricas ArchiMate é uma jornada rumo à maturidade. Ela move a organização do combate reativo a uma planejamento proativo. Ao quantificar a integridade estrutural da sua arquitetura empresarial, você capacita os stakeholders a tomarem decisões melhores.
O caminho adiante exige compromisso. Exige que você trate o modelo de arquitetura como um ativo vivo que exige cuidados regulares. Exige colaboração entre negócios e TI para garantir que as métricas reflitam a realidade. Quando feito corretamente, essas métricas fornecem um sinal claro sobre onde a organização está e para onde precisa ir.
Comece pequeno. Escolha uma ou duas métricas para focar, como Grau de Acoplamento e Cobertura de Camadas. Estabeleça uma base. Depois, trabalhe para melhorar esses números ao longo do tempo. À medida que a cultura da medição se consolidar, você descobrirá que a arquitetura se torna um facilitador estratégico, e não uma restrição.
Lembre-se, o objetivo não é a perfeição. O objetivo é visibilidade e controle. Com as métricas certas em vigor, você ganha a confiança para navegar pelas complexidades do cenário digital. Essa é a essência de uma arquitetura empresarial saudável e resiliente.











